A 3D Brain Geometry Toolkit for Multisite Neuroimaging Analysis

Compared to traditional gross volumetrics, surface- based models provide greater spatial precision for understanding brain alterations related to developmental, neurological, and psychiatric disorders. Large-scale brain initiatives are combining data from around the world to discover and improve illness- related brain markers. Here, we present a toolkit for 3D brain geometry analysis aimed at addressing key challenges facing large- scale neuroimaging studies. Our framework incorporates scalable methods for multisite data integration, site-specific confound correction, accelerated statistical modeling, interpretable machine learning, and interactive results visualization.
